> On Fri, Oct 05, 2012 at 11:37:40PM +0100, Mans Rullgard wrote:
>> The problem is the (__be32 *) casts.  This is a normal pointer to a 32-bit,
>> which is assumed to be aligned, and the cast overrides the packed attribute
>> from the struct.  Dereferencing these cast expressions must be done with the
>> macros from asm/unaligned.h
>
> Again, not going to happen.

There are only two options for fixing this:

1. Ensure the struct is always aligned.
2. Declare it packed (and fix casts).

Refusing to do either leaves us with a broken kernel.  Is that what you want?
